Introduction to Mechanical Tuners:
TURRET TUNER:
The turret tuner or drum type tuner is so named since coils for several channels are accumulated on a slotted drum type structure that k rotated through the channel selector. The tuned circuits are accumulated on separate strips for each channel that are clipped into the turret. The coils needed are selected through rotating the turret so preserving the shortest probable length of connections. Every strip contains coils for RF amplifier, local oscillator and mixer for a single channel. The schematic of a VHF turret tuner displayed in diagram demonstrates the way in which a coil-strip on the drum creates connections with the rest of the circuit.
WAFER OR INCREMENTAL TUNER:
This tuner uses a wafer switch type construction in which a tier of wafer switches allows selection of the appropriate mixer, RF, and oscillator coils. The coils are generally accumulated around the outer rim of the switch along with a few turns of wire for the lower channels and increasingly decreasing for the higher channels. To connect one set of RF The wafer switch is rotated, mixer and oscillator coils for every channel diagram displays schematic of VHF tuner-wafer switches. Note: the coils for oscillator, RF amplifier, and mixer stages are on separate wafer switches that ganged on a common shaft. The oscillator coils are all the time on the front section for convenience of adjusting the inductance to set the frequency.
The wafer type tuners are also termed as incremental tuners since the change of channel is accomplished through an increasing shorting of sections of the total inductance. 2 to 6 individual coils are connected in series and are increasingly shorted out for channels. 7 to 11 only single rum or half a turn is enough for tuning, for channels.
Channel I is not allocated for TV broadcasting anymore and this position on the selector switch is usually employed to start the UHF A tune. The current version of tuner wafer construction uses a printed I circuit wafer. In this technique all coils for higher channels are replaced through printed circuit inductances. This technique has the benefits of better reliability, better uniformity of alignment and lower cost.
